What Makes a Transmission Client the Best Option for Android?
The best transmission clients for Android offer a combination of user-friendly interfaces, efficient performance, and robust features tailored for mobile users.
- uTorrent: uTorrent is one of the most popular torrent clients, known for its lightweight design and speed. It allows users to download torrents quickly while consuming minimal resources, making it ideal for mobile devices. The app also includes features like Wi-Fi-only mode, allowing users to conserve data by restricting downloads to Wi-Fi networks.
- Flud: Flud is a powerful torrent downloader that offers a clean and intuitive interface. It supports magnet links and allows users to download multiple torrents simultaneously with customizable bandwidth settings. Additionally, Flud provides options for selecting specific files within torrents, which is beneficial for saving storage space on mobile devices.
- Torrent Downloader: This client is designed specifically for Android and offers a simple, yet effective, way to manage torrent downloads. It features a built-in media player for previewing files before they finish downloading and supports both magnetic links and torrent files. Torrent Downloader also includes a unique feature of scheduling downloads, allowing users to optimize their download times.
- BitTorrent: The BitTorrent app brings the classic torrent experience to mobile users with a familiar interface. It allows for seamless integration with the BitTorrent protocol and includes features like a built-in music and video player for instant playback. Users can also create and manage torrents directly from the app, making it a versatile tool for both downloading and sharing content.
- LibreTorrent: LibreTorrent is an open-source torrent client that prioritizes user privacy and features a customizable interface. It supports various protocols and allows for in-depth configuration options, appealing to advanced users who want more control over their downloads. The app is ad-free and respects user data, making it a preferred choice for those concerned about privacy.

How Can Users Troubleshoot Common Issues with Transmission Clients?
Users can troubleshoot common issues with transmission clients by following these steps:
- Check Internet Connection: Ensure that your device has a stable internet connection, as transmission clients require consistent connectivity to function properly. A weak or intermittent connection can lead to failed downloads or uploads.
- Update the App: Keeping your transmission client updated is crucial for fixing bugs and improving performance. Developers regularly release updates that address known issues and enhance compatibility with various file formats.
- Verify Torrent Files: Sometimes, the issue may stem from corrupt or incomplete torrent files. Users should ensure that the torrent files they are downloading are from reliable sources and are not damaged.
- Check Firewall and Antivirus Settings: Firewalls and antivirus software can block transmission clients from accessing the internet. Users should check these settings to ensure that the app is allowed to communicate freely without restrictions.
- Adjust Bandwidth Settings: If downloads are slow or frequently interrupted, users can try adjusting the bandwidth settings within the client. Limiting download and upload speeds can sometimes stabilize connections and improve overall performance.
- Restart the Application: A simple restart can often resolve temporary glitches. Closing and reopening the transmission client can clear up minor issues that may be causing problems.
- Clear Cache and Data: Over time, a buildup of cache and data can slow down the app or lead to errors. Users can clear the cache and data from their device settings to refresh the app and free up resources.
